Improper Authentication in SPPA-T3000 Application Server - CVE-2019-18317

Detailed vulnerability description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to bypass authentication process.

The vulnerability exists due to an error in authentication process. A remote attacker can send specially crafted objects via RMI, bypass authentication process and cause a denial of service (DoS) condition on the target system.
